Grant Overview

Priority Outcomes for Idaho's Public Safety Research Initiatives

The Unrestricted Grants to Support Research for Public Safety, funded by a Banking Institution, aims to address pressing challenges in crime prevention and law enforcement within Idaho. To achieve this goal, the grant program prioritizes research-based knowledge and newly developed tools that tackle specific priorities and resolve challenges in the state's public safety landscape.

Key Areas of Focus for Idaho's Public Safety Research

Idaho's unique geography, with its vast rural areas and mountainous terrain, presents distinct challenges for law enforcement agencies. The Idaho State Police, in collaboration with local law enforcement agencies, has identified key areas of focus for public safety research initiatives. These areas include improving rural law enforcement capabilities, enhancing emergency response times, and developing effective strategies to address the growing issue of methamphetamine trafficking in the state.

Research initiatives that focus on these priority areas are likely to receive consideration under this grant program. For instance, studies on the effectiveness of community-based programs in reducing crime rates in Idaho's rural counties, such as those in the Salmon River region, could provide valuable insights for law enforcement agencies. Additionally, research on the use of technology, such as data analytics and predictive policing tools, to enhance crime prevention and investigation efforts in Idaho's urban areas, like Boise, could also be a priority.

The Idaho Department of Correction's efforts to reduce recidivism rates through evidence-based programs also align with the grant's objectives. Research that evaluates the effectiveness of these programs and identifies areas for improvement could be a valuable contribution to the state's public safety initiatives. Furthermore, studies on the impact of Idaho's frontier counties on law enforcement services, including the challenges posed by limited resources and vast distances, may also be relevant.
